Captain Paolo Benini Departs Costa for MSC Cruises

Submitted by kgnadmin on

After a long-standing career of 34 years with Costa Cruises, Captain Paolo Benini has announced his departure from the company to embark on a new chapter in his professional career with MSC Cruises. Through a message on social media, Captain Benini expressed his gratitude towards Costa Cruises for the wonderful years and the opportunity to grow into the professional he is today.

Virgin Voyages' Brilliant Lady Completes Dry Dock Before Delivery

Submitted by kgnadmin on

The newbuild cruise ship Brilliant Lady has recently completed her last dry dock before her much-anticipated delivery to Virgin Voyages. This significant milestone took place at the Fincantieri shipyard in Palermo, Sicily, on Saturday, February 24, 2024. As the fourth and final vessel tailored for Virgin Voyagesthe Brilliant Lady is poised to make waves in the coming months, although the exact date for her operational debut remains under wraps.

Mauritius Denies Norwegian Dawn Disembarkation Over Health Concerns

Submitted by kgnadmin on

The Mauritius Ports Authority has decided not to let passengers off the Norwegian Cruise Line's Norwegian Dawn ship because of health concerns. The ship, which requested to dock at Port Louis, was placed under quarantine due to stomach-related issues affecting some passengers. This decision was made to prevent any health concerns, authorities said. According to reports in Mauritius, stomach-related illness could be caused by GI or cholera.
